High Noon
Expanding
their cinema-scopic surf sound by grafting bits of country, Vegas lounge,
60's girl group, and Luna-like guitar excursions into an already exciting
mix, The Lost Patrol make touring drummer Seth Clifford a permanent member
alongside multi-instrumentalist Stephen Masucci, new acoustic guitarist
Michael Williams, and vocalist/guitarist Danielle Kimak Stauss. Another
outstanding collection of music that completely captures the sound, feel
and, more importantly, the mood sought by The Lost Patrol, highlights
include: the Luna-does-Shadowy Men surf barrage of "Deep Stage";
a mournfully misty "Far, Far Away" (beamed in on a time-warped
signal from a 1961 radio broadcast including The Chantels?); a shiveringly
hypnotic "Neon Cowgirl"; and a truly definitive version of the
James Bond theme song, "You Only Live Twice". ~ Al Muzer
